Revision a0a8793e hw/mips_malta.c
b/hw/mips_malta.c | ||
---|---|---|
538 | 538 |
stl_raw(p++, 0x34e70000 | (env->ram_size & 0xffff)); /* ori a3, a3, low(env->ram_size) */ |
539 | 539 |
|
540 | 540 |
/* Load BAR registers as done by YAMON */ |
541 |
stl_raw(p++, 0x3c09b400); /* lui t1, 0xb400 */ |
|
542 |
|
|
543 |
#ifdef TARGET_WORDS_BIGENDIAN |
|
544 |
stl_raw(p++, 0x3c08df00); /* lui t0, 0xdf00 */ |
|
545 |
#else |
|
546 |
stl_raw(p++, 0x340800df); /* ori t0, r0, 0x00df */ |
|
547 |
#endif |
|
548 |
stl_raw(p++, 0xad280068); /* sw t0, 0x0068(t1) */ |
|
549 |
|
|
541 | 550 |
stl_raw(p++, 0x3c09bbe0); /* lui t1, 0xbbe0 */ |
542 | 551 |
|
543 | 552 |
#ifdef TARGET_WORDS_BIGENDIAN |
Also available in: Unified diff